23// This file provides a wrapper for getenv that appends the userid (geteuid())
24// of the current process to GCOV_PREFIX. This avoids conflicts and permissions
25// issues when different processes try to create/access the same directories and
26// files under $GCOV_PREFIX.
27//
28// When this file is linked to a binary, the -Wl,--wrap,getenv flag must be
29// used. The linker redirects calls to getenv to __wrap_getenv and sets
30// __real_getenv to point to libc's getenv.
